Brief summary

Physically demanding occupations (PDO) require high levels of energy expenditure, mental acuity, and technical skills. Sometimes this work is performed in extreme environments during hot/humid summer months. Previous research shows that dehydration and heat stress can increase risk of heat-related illness, reduced cognitive function, and work capacity. While this impact of physically demanding work in extreme environmental conditions is often studied in firefighters, military personnel, and athletes, and even agricultural workers, manufacturing and warehouse workers (the industrial athlete) are underrepresented in the literature. The purpose of the study is to examine the impact hydration status of the industrial athlete (i.e., frontline manufacturing and warehouse workers at PepsiCo facilities) prior to, during, and after their shift over a typical work week has on work performance. Prior Night Sleep Quality30 minutes pre- 8-12 hour shift on consecutive test day 1-4, over a calendar weekPittsburgh Sleep Quality Index (PSQI). Measures sleep quality through seven areas: subjective sleep quality, sleep latency, sleep duration, habitual sleep efficiency, sleep disturbances, use of sleep medication, and daytime dysfunction over the last month. Score of the PSQI ranges from 0 to 3, with 3 indicating the greatest dysfunction or disturbance. The seven component scores are then summed to obtain a global PSQI score, which ranges from 0 to 21. Higher scores indicate poorer sleep quality, with a score greater than 5 suggesting significant sleep difficulties
